若是从其他地方导入的新工程,右边maven管理工具中dependencies若出现红色波浪线。通常用以下方式尝试解决。第一步0.导入外部项目,先配置jdk。1.(检查maven仓库配置是否正确)File-->settings输入maven,检查Mavendirectory,localrepository的配置和settings.xml中配置的仓库地址。2.(重新导包)打开编译器右边的maven管理工具,点击reimportallmavenprojects。3.(改动pom文件)install报红的项目,从maven库下载需要的包,如果还不能解决,去maven项目所在的pom文件,把相应包去掉,
在开发过程这如果需要引入一些,MAVEN仓库中没有的JAR包,或者引入一些别人写的一些工具类jar包。(1)在项目下创建lib目录,将需要引入的jar包复制进去(2)如果你想在代码中使用你需要选择jar包右击"AddasLibrary.…",把jar改jar作为一个依赖。点击之后,这个jar包会有一个下拉箭头(3)把该jar包,在pom.xml文件中引入com.thread.encrptencrpt1.0system${project.basedir}/lib/encrptToolV1.0.jar注意:groupId:自定义artifactId:自定义version:自定义scope:必须是s
将现有的Maven项目导入Eclipse时,我的根pom.xml标记为红色。当我在pom.xml上选择消息时:Can'timportprojectXYZfromanexistingworkspacefolder这只发生在根pom.xml中使用中的Eclipse:LunaServiceRelease2(4.4.2)Eclipse1.5.2.20150413-2215的Maven集成我已经测试了许多不同的maven项目和不同的工作区。请注意这之前有效,我一直在研究一些教程并创建了许多具有相同名称和ArtifactID等的Maven项目。我已经删除了所有早期的项目,但还会有一些冲突吗?任何建
将现有的Maven项目导入Eclipse时,我的根pom.xml标记为红色。当我在pom.xml上选择消息时:Can'timportprojectXYZfromanexistingworkspacefolder这只发生在根pom.xml中使用中的Eclipse:LunaServiceRelease2(4.4.2)Eclipse1.5.2.20150413-2215的Maven集成我已经测试了许多不同的maven项目和不同的工作区。请注意这之前有效,我一直在研究一些教程并创建了许多具有相同名称和ArtifactID等的Maven项目。我已经删除了所有早期的项目,但还会有一些冲突吗?任何建
当我打开一个POM文件并单击底部的“依赖层次结构”选项卡时,它给了我错误“项目读取错误”。它适用于同一工作区中的其他项目,但不适用于这个。有什么想法吗?编辑回应@Yhn的回答。在Eclipse之外从命令行运行编译和打包阶段按预期工作。它编译应用程序并构建最终的WAR文件。Eclipse确实指向Mavensettings.xml文件的默认位置,因此它应该知道其中定义的自定义存储库(我的公司有自己的Maven存储库)。我可以从Eclipse中打开和编辑POM文件,因此它必须具有该文件的读/写权限。该项目在Eclipse中没有配置为Maven项目,所以我无法从Eclipse运行打包阶段(我只
当我打开一个POM文件并单击底部的“依赖层次结构”选项卡时,它给了我错误“项目读取错误”。它适用于同一工作区中的其他项目,但不适用于这个。有什么想法吗?编辑回应@Yhn的回答。在Eclipse之外从命令行运行编译和打包阶段按预期工作。它编译应用程序并构建最终的WAR文件。Eclipse确实指向Mavensettings.xml文件的默认位置,因此它应该知道其中定义的自定义存储库(我的公司有自己的Maven存储库)。我可以从Eclipse中打开和编辑POM文件,因此它必须具有该文件的读/写权限。该项目在Eclipse中没有配置为Maven项目,所以我无法从Eclipse运行打包阶段(我只
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。要求代码的问题必须表明对正在解决的问题的最低理解。包括尝试的解决方案、它们为什么不起作用以及预期结果。另见:StackOverflowquestionchecklist关闭9年前。ImprovethisquestionPOM文件的主要特点是什么,为什么实际使用它?依赖关系如何映射到我们提供给它的Java虚拟机并在应用程序上变得灵活? 最佳答案 AProjectObjectModelorPOMisthefundamentalunitofworkinM
已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。要求代码的问题必须表明对正在解决的问题的最低理解。包括尝试的解决方案、它们为什么不起作用以及预期结果。另见:StackOverflowquestionchecklist关闭9年前。ImprovethisquestionPOM文件的主要特点是什么,为什么实际使用它?依赖关系如何映射到我们提供给它的Java虚拟机并在应用程序上变得灵活? 最佳答案 AProjectObjectModelorPOMisthefundamentalunitofworkinM
今天在给一个小伙伴配置项目中有一个jar包依赖怎么就下载不下来,关键是我使用他的maven本地仓库打包还报错。首先这个依赖maven官网仓库是存在的,也是可以下载的,但是他本地就是下载不下来。尝试了很多的方法,搞笑的是还给他重新安装了另一个版本的maven。但是本地仓库打包还是报错,报错信息:org.apache.commons.cli.MissingArgumentException:Missingargumentforoption:f 。我也百度了这个报错的原因,有的说是maven打包命令复制网页上的会存在其他看不见的字符需要自己手动敲,哈哈我就傻乎乎的手敲了几遍但是还是报错。最后我放
每次我在Eclipse中更改pom.xml时都会收到错误消息。Builderrorsformyapp;org.apache.maven.lifecycle.LifecycleExecutionException:Failedtoexecutegoalorg.apache.maven.plugins:maven-compiler-plugin:2.0.2:compile(default-compile)onprojectweb:CompilationfailureUnabletolocatetheJavacCompilerin:C:\ProgramFiles(x86)\Java\jre6